I am thinking about signing up for Canada Post's Flex Delivery service in order to avoid parcels going missing. How would this work with Paypal? Can I add the post office address as a shipping address? Or can parcels only be sent to my confirmed address, ie home address? Thanks for any advice.

I think you have to add the Flex address to paypal as one of your shipping choices.
Then you pick which address to use when buying.
I have run into a few Flex addresses this year for stuff I've sold. No problems.

You add a new address as a mailing address on eBay.
Before you buy you identify a Primary Shipping Address. on eBay.
Once something has been purchased this Primary Shipping Address becomes the buyer's address on Paypal
and ... Most important ...
This address on Paypal cannot be changed.....
This is a major point of protection for sellers... A buyer cannot redirect a parcel to a new address.....
